Where to install heat pump pool
A heat pump for a swimming pool must be placed outside because it draws heat from the outside air. The most common location is outside next to the pool. It is important to have enough space for the heat pump and provide proper ventilation for it to function properly. It is also advisable to place the heat pump near the pool to reduce energy loss.
When we talk about the installation of your pool heat pump, we're talking about outdoor air! Your heat pump can heat pool water from an outside temperature of 15°C. By placing the heat pump outside, it can extract heat from the air and emit cold air. If you placed the heat pump inside, too much cold air would remain in the room. This would hinder the pump's operation and cause it to freeze itself. We want to avoid that, of course. So the heat pump should always be outdoors!
In addition, it is important to consider possible noise pollution to nearby residents, as heat pumps can produce noise during the heating process.

How does a heat pump pool work
A pool heat pump works on the principle of heat transfer. It extracts heat from ambient air, groundwater or soil and releases it to the water in the pool. This is done using a compressor, a heat exchanger and a refrigerant. The heat pump uses electricity to evaporate and condense the refrigerant, releasing heat to the pool water. The process is repeated continuously until the desired temperature is reached.

What factors influence the efficiency of a pool heat pump?
The efficiency of a pool heat pump is affected by several factors, including the outside temperature, the insulation of the pool, the size of the pool and the proper sizing of the heat pump. A well-insulated pool with properly sized heat pump will operate more efficiently and save energy. It is also important to perform regular maintenance and keep the heat pump clean to maintain efficiency.
Another important factor that can affect the efficiency of a pool heat pump is the location of the pool. For example, if the pool is located in a windy area, this can affect the heat output of the heat pump, reducing its efficiency. Therefore, it is advisable to consider environmental factors when installing a pool to ensure the optimal performance of the heat pump.
In addition to the factors mentioned above, the water balance of the pool also affects the efficiency of the heat pump. A well-balanced water chemistry allows the heat pump to function optimally and reduces the risk of scale and corrosion, which can extend the life of the heat pump. Regularly checking and adjusting the water balance is therefore essential to maintaining the efficiency and proper operation of the pool heat pump.

How to choose the right size pool heat pump for your pool?
The proper size of a pool heat pump can depend on several factors, including the size of your pool, the desired pool temperature and the insulation of the pool. It is important to choose a heat pump that has the capacity to heat your pool efficiently. A heat pump that is too small will struggle to bring the water to the desired temperature, while a heat pump that is too large will use energy unnecessarily. It is advisable to seek advice from a professional to determine the right size heat pump for your pool.
In addition to the size of your pool, it is also essential to consider the location of your pool. For example, if your pool is heavily shaded, this can affect heat distribution and thus the required capacity of the heat pump. In addition, the weather conditions in your region also play a role. In colder climates, you may need a more powerful heat pump to keep the water at the desired temperature.
